Amazon.com
The Remington King of Shaves AZOR 5 5-Blade Razor will give you a clean and confident look every day. Using a soft-flex hinge and thin, fine blades, the AZOR 5 gives those with sensitive skin a close, comfortable shave without razor burn. An endurium coating on each blade makes the cartridges long lasting, providing you with more shaves for your money.
Azor 5-Blade Men's
Manual Razor
At a Glance:
- Optimized for sensitive skin; achieves close shaves without razor burn
- Soft-Flex hinge applies just the right amount of pressure to your skin
- 5 blades are coated with long-lasting endurium nano to give more shaves for your money
- Provides comfort and efficiency with an ergonomic handle and slimline cartridge
- Soft touch cartridge ejector designed for easy cartridge change
- Beard bumper lifts stubble for a smoother shave
Five Fine Blades for a Close, Comfortable Shave
The AZOR 5 provides those with sensitive skin the closest shave possible. Using S-Flex technology and an ergonomic handle design, the handle's soft-flex hinge presses blades gently against the skin, avoiding abrasion--even along the natural curves of your face and neck.
Slimline Design Provides a Convenient Shaving Experience
Areas that are normally troublesome during shaving are no problem when using the AZOR 5. The ergonomic handle design allows you to comfortably control where you guide your razor. The cartridges' slimline design makes precision grooming easy in tricky areas, such as under the nose. In addition, the cartridge has a skin pre-tensioning beard bumper to help lift stubble during shaving, reducing the risk of nicks and cuts and providing a smoother shave.
Endurium-Coated Blades Give More Shaves for Your Money
This model uses five thin, fine blades to maintain close contact and reduce razor burn. And like all Remington razors, it is built to last, so you can maintain both your look and your wallet. Each blade on the AZOR 5 is coated with endurium nano, giving you a dependably comfortable experience shave after shave.
The razor comes with three endurium replacement cartridges, giving you 50 percent more cartridges in each pack. When it comes time to change your blade, the soft touch cartridge ejector makes it easy.

- Reviewed in the United States on February 19, 2013I compare this product to the very best shave I've ever had from one of those fancy powered Fusion shavers, and this is every bit as good for a fraction of the price. I shave every day, and with my tough hair and sensitive skin I can barely go a week with a Fusion blade head before tossing it. With the Azor-5, I can go 2 weeks with a shave head, and then I only toss it because it seems like maybe it isn't quite as sharp but my face doesn't get sensitive. So maybe I can go longer. The real deal is in the refill blades, where I get 6 refills for the Azor-5 for about 2/3 the price of a 4-pack of the Fusion refills making each blade head 1/2 the price of the Fusion heads. Half the price, twice the life, four times the bargain, and my face loves me. Pair this with their King of Shaves gel and you won't be sorry.
Caveat: I know how to stretch and twist my face so that I can shave under my nose, but if I had Karl Malden's nose then I might have trouble with this under my nose. I'm fortunate to not be cursed with a grotesque bulbous probiscous.

- Reviewed in the United States on January 25, 2012I really wanted this razor to work. I have used King of Shaves shaving gel for a long time now and loved it. Plus the blades are properly priced compared to really everyone else. But this is literally the worst razor I have ever used. On my first shave the blades got clogged with hair that would not come out after rinsing. A few times I have had to clean it out with a clothes pin because the hair got so stuck in there. Secondly, the shave is wildly uneven. While it is pretty good at convex surfaces like the corner of the mouth, it is terrible at concave areas like the neck. So long as I have used it, the only way to get an even neck shave is to shave against the grain or clean up with another razor. Lastly, their "Endurium" coated blades are extremely cheap themselves. With a name based in science fiction rather than science, I have already gone through the provided 3 heads after only 5 shaves. Granted I grow a little scruff between shaves, but never more than two days worth and my hair is not very thick at all.
I was a sucker and bought a refill of heads, never thinking that a razor could be this bad. I am going to try to shave more regularly with them, and hopefully they will fair better. If I find them more useful, I will return to revise my review, but until then, don't believe the hype. The reason this razor is so inexpensive is because it is cheap.
